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Brown Shrimp | Jamaican fruit bat |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Arthropoda (Arthropods)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Malacostraca (Crustaceans)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Decapoda (Decapoda) | Chiroptera (Bats) |
| Family | Penaeidae | Phyllostomidae |
| Genus | Penaeus | Artibeus |
| Species | Penaeus aztecus | Artibeus jamaicensis |
Evolutionary Relationship
Brown Shrimp and Jamaican fruit bat share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Animalia. (Animals)
